  3. I've found 2 very serious bugs with this power set

    1- The electric animation for the second shield power (I believe it was Conductive Shield) causes SERIOUS graphical lag inside cave missions for some reason. The lag happens every single time at the end of the electric animation loop.

    2- If you do a bind like '/bind z "powexec_name Sprint"' and use the bind you can no longer turn off your toggles by clicking them with the mouse. For some reason a single click sends a double click when you try to click off a toggle. So the toggle comes right back on once it recharges. Resetting all your binds seems to make the bug go away, but every bind I tried triggered this bug.
